Abstract: | This article in the journal Gruppe. Interaktion. Organisation (GIO) presents mindfulness as a starting point for coping with the increasing and changing demands of today’s workplaces. Based on a differentiated analysis of mindfulness on the individual and organizational level, we discuss their separate contribution to resilient behavior in the workplace as well as on psychological well-being and work engagement. These assumptions were empirically verified. Overall, 172 persons participated in the study, which was implemented as a web-based questionnaire. The results showed that individual and organizational mindfulness independently contributed to resilient behavior in the workplace. Furthermore, individual mindfulness and resilient behavior promoted psychological well-being. Both individual and organizational mindfulness were significantly associated with work engagement. Additional analyses revealed that these effects were mediated by resilient behavior. In summary, the results demonstrated that individual and organizational mindfulness are distinct constructs whose influence on psychological well-being and work engagement could be partly explained by resilient behavior in the workplace. |
